In 2018, Fidelitas implemented Sisthema Panthera ERP - Document Management to centralize document workflows and support critical business functions such as customer service, billing, and production control. The initiative addressed a layered information architecture that constrained development, and the deployment targeted a thorough process redesign to align systems with the company’s multifaceted security and cash handling services.
Panthera was tailored with customized production control modules and specific contracting and invoicing functions to automate tasks previously handled manually. Document Management and workflow management capabilities were configured and are being gradually extended across company processes to dematerialize paper flows and centralize customer documents, while a specially developed software component supports money counting customer service.
Operational coverage focuses on administrative, production control, customer service, and billing functions that support Fidelitas’s service lines, including cash transport, cash counting, alarm center connections, and vault services. The implementation enabled periodic reports to be visible to customers online with filters and password protection, improving access to transactional and contract documentation for external stakeholders.
Governance included a staged rollout of Document Management and workflow orchestration across departments, with process redesign embedded in module configuration to support complaint handling and reporting workflows. Outcomes called out by the project include computerized internal administrative processes, paper flow dematerialization, automated complaint management with status tracking, improved customer service for money counting, and stated gains in efficiency, savings, and service quality.
